I don't know if it's all about wave height with a tsunami.
A regular wave has a small length and width compared to a tsunami.
The total volume of water moving toward the shore is more important.
The tsunami is moving much faster and with more force than a regular wave.

A tsunami is a SHOCK WAVE! It's not just water.
